The 2020-2021 NBA season will start well on December 22, this was confirmed by the North American Basketball League on Monday evening, after reaching an agreement with the players' union (NBPA) on the various terms of the recovery and on financial terms.

"This agreement must still be submitted to the vote of the board of directors of the league", bringing together the owners of franchises, said the two bodies in their joint press release.

Last Friday, the players voted in favor of the NBA plan, even if some would have preferred that the re-entry be around Martin Luther King Day (January 18), so as not to return to the courts too soon, the finalists from last season, Lakers and Heat, having played until mid-October.

The Draft set for November 18

The game will therefore restart for them a little over two months later, on Tuesday, December 22, but almost nine months later for eight clubs including the Golden State Warriors, who had not been affected by the end of the previous championship, after its interruption on March 11.

Each team will play 72 regular season games, the schedule of which will be revealed in the coming weeks.

The opening of the transfer market has been set for November 20, two days after the Draft.

This period of transactions should be extremely intense as the training camps will start only ten days later, from December 1st.
